can i make my own home made server ?

 

Yes you can

 

if yes , what do i need ?

 

The exact same files from your client (your mw2 folder) just make a second copy with all the files in, add a server.cfg to the /main folder this can be found here http://www.mediafire.com/?fqoh0c4ias06rlc just edit the name of the server and your map_rotation.

 

Now add a parameter to the shortcut (in target) e.g "-dedicated +set party_maxplayers 18 +set net_port 28961 +exec server.cfg +map_rotate"

 

note: you can use your own port also, and DO NOT delete the target, this parameter goes straight after it.

You need to port forward if no one told u.

that is for people to see the server on the server list , or is it to people be abble to connect to the server?

Both :D

 

You need to port forward the port you're using e.g. if you're using 28961 then open that on your local ip TCP/UDP.

 

While you're there, might as well make your local ip static
